首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

MS Access(MDB)并发

在云计算领域中,MS Access(MDB)并发是指在多用户环境下,同时访问和操作同一个MS Access数据库文件(MDB文件)的能力。MS Access数据库是一种常用的数据库管理系统,它可以方便地管理和操作数据,但在多用户并发访问时,可能会出现数据不一致、数据冲突等问题。为了解决这些问题,需要采用一些并发控制策略和技术。

MS Access并发控制主要有以下几种策略:

  1. 乐观锁:乐观锁假设在数据被多个用户同时访问时,冲突的可能性较低,因此只在提交数据时检查数据是否发生冲突。如果发生冲突,则需要重新开始事务。
  2. 悲观锁:悲观锁假设在数据被多个用户同时访问时,冲突的可能性较高,因此在读取数据时就进行加锁,确保数据在事务期间不被其他用户修改。
  3. 时间戳:时间戳是在数据上加一个时间戳,每次更新数据时,都会更新时间戳。如果有冲突,则以时间戳大的数据为准。
  4. 版本控制:版本控制是在数据上加一个版本号,每次更新数据时,都会更新版本号。如果有冲突,则以版本号大的数据为准。

在MS Access中,可以使用上述并发控制策略来解决并发访问的问题。具体实现方式可以参考MS Access的官方文档和相关资料。

在云计算领域中,腾讯云提供了一系列的数据库产品和服务,包括云数据库MySQL、云数据库PostgreSQL、云数据库SQL Server、云数据库MongoDB等,可以满足不同场景下的数据存储和管理需求。同时,腾讯云也提供了一系列的数据库管理工具和服务,包括数据库迁移服务、数据库备份服务、数据库监控服务等,可以帮助用户更好地管理和维护数据库。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• MS SQL Server事务与并发知多少

    事务是数据库并发控制的基本单位,一条或者一组语句要么全部成功,对数据库中的某些数据成功修改; 要么全部不成功,数据库中的数据还原到这些语句执行之前的样子。...隔离性(Isolation):与数据库中的事务隔离级别以及锁相关,多个用户可以对同一数据并发访问而又不破坏数据的正确性和完整性。但是,并行事务的修改必须与其它并行事务的修改相互独立,隔离。...Sales.OrderDetails SET unitprice = 15.20 WHERE productid = 2 AND orderid < 10500; 五、小结   本篇介绍了事务和并发...相信随着这些内容的理解,我们对事务和并发的认知不再停留在数据库基础的教材里边,也希望对大家有所帮助。...最后推荐各位使用MS SQL Server的程序员们都阅读一下《MS SQL Server 2008技术内幕:T-SQL语言基础》这本书,真的是值得阅读的一本。

    2.3K11

    基于C#的Access MsSQL MySQL 三种数据库访问演示(含源文件Demo)

    就笔者目前的体会来说一下三种数据库的用途:     Access:数据库载体是单个*.mdb文件,而且可以用Microsoft Access以文档的方式打开,拥有良好的数据库构架,方便程序访问,一般用于小型的桌面应用程序的数据存储载体...MS Sql Server:基于网络访问,比较适合选作为B/S,C/S程序的数据库。     MySql:其主要特点、用法和MS Sql Server比较类似,最大的优点就是开源,便宜。  ...总述:AccessMS Sql Server比较容易学习和入门,但是如果用作商业用途的时候,可以选用MySql,它们用法类似,但价格却区别很大。... 连接访问演示 /// 要求:将ACCESS数据库文件*.mdb放到bin根目录下面 /// private static  void...:只要有*.mdb文件即可。

    1.3K20

    如何在电脑上打开access

    请问在VB环境下编程,或者其他环境需要用到access,例如access考试学习;如何实现用DAO对象打开一个带密码的Access数据库进行读写.首先下载安装access地址 http://pan.baidu.swj.wang.../ms/accessVisualBasic与Access数据库紧密集成,Access数据库通常由以下几部分组成。...3、最后“确定”即可设置DAO数据类型变量DAO数据类型变量分为两种类型:1、数据库ˌ资料库变量对应于Access数据库,通常在模块中定义为公共全局变量:PublicAccessDBFAsDatabase...DimsConeectAsStringSConnect='PWD=8830428;UID=admin'打开时设置用户名、口令等参数SetAccessDBF=无确认关闭对象实例SetAccessDBF=工作区(打开数据库(App.Path'ToXls.MDB...',False,sConnect)打开当前路径的ToXls.MDB数据库EndSub2、打开记录集的方法记录集遵循即时打开的原则,所以通常在函数中打开SetthePrintTable=AcessDBF.

    1.5K00

    线下赛ASP靶机漏洞利用分析

    从图中可以看到采用 access 数据库,从而排除了之前我们分析的使用 mssql 数据库的可能性。 4.寻找后台有哪些功能 ?...这 3 点防数据库下载的措施: 1.修改默认数据库名,修改存放目录 2.把 access 数据库的 .MDB 扩展名修改为 asp、asa ,不影响下载 3.数据库名加 # 防止被下载,但是可以通过 %...先尝试修改为 asp 扩展名,果不然出现了内容,那我只要把该 asp 文件下载下来再改名为 mdb 文件,进行读取 ?...之前那篇文章提权采用 ms15-077,同样在该靶机上也可以提权成功 ? 但咱也不能老用那 1 个 exp,所以这次咱换一个 1 个 ms15-051 试试。 ?...执行了但是没内容输出 后来找了下 ms15-051 的 exp 相关信息,发现得配合菜刀的自写脚本功能使用 ? ?

    2.2K00

    刘金玉的零基础VB教程079期:数据库增删改查

    视频讲解 https://v.qq.com/x/page/p0942erecnh.html 文字讲解 刘金玉的零基础VB教程079期: 数据库增删改查 步骤 1、创建数据库(access 2003版本(...mdb)、2007以后版本(accdb) ) 2、创建表users,新建字段(表头):username、password、sex 3、创建增加数据的界面 4、引用数据库操作对象,写代码:创建一个连接对象...、利用数据集创建数据对象、执行数据库操作语句 5、首先要获取到数据库连接字符串,如果是mdb类型的数据库,那么字符串 "Provider=Microsoft.jet.OLEDB.4.0;Data Source....12.0;Data Source=" & App.Path & "\test.mdb;Persist Security Info=False" ?...课堂总结 1、掌握数据库的创建(两种方法用VB软件、直接创建access) 2、掌握数据库的连接 3、掌握数据库的数据集对象的使用方法 4、学会基本的sql语句,更多的数据库知识关注我的新教程节目access

    1.6K20
    领券